The University Center at UW-Whitewater is a place where students can chill out and have fun outside of their dorms. The facility hosts activities and invites entertainers of all kinds to bring fun to campus. This spring semester has a lineup that will surely be enjoyed by many.

As a “welcome back to campus” event, the UC Live crew is hosting a “Winterfest – Casino Night” Friday, Jan. 26. Events at Warhawk Alley start at 10 a.m., but the real fun begins at 7 p.m. with mug/plate/snowman pin painting at Ike Schaffer Commons and karaoke in the Down Under. Magician and comedian Tyler Korso will be performing two sets, one starting at 7 p.m. and the other at 8:30 p.m. There will be a casino at the UC Concourse and Bingo in the Hamilton Room. There will also be mocktails and snacks outside of Einstein Bros. Bagels.

Every Thursday at 7 p.m., the Down Under hosts some sort of entertainment, whether that is bringing in an entertainer or relying on students to be the entertainment. Starting off Feb. 1, the improv group “Mission IMPROVable” will be visiting for a night of improv. Other entertainers coming are UW-La Crosse graduate hypnotist Chris Jones Feb. 8, storyteller Odd Rod Feb. 29, comedian Ahmed Al-Kadri March 7, magician Noah Sonie March 14, singer Matthew Schuler April 4, and comedian AJ Wilkerson April 11.

The Down Under also has their share of student-lead entertainment. They have Marvel Movie Trivia Feb. 15, Game Show Night Feb. 22, Karaoke March 21 and May 2, and Open Mic Night April 25. UC Live also hosts special events. Some to look forward to are a Masquerade Ball Friday, Feb. 16 at 7 p.m., a scavenger hunt Friday, March 15, and a petting zoo Friday, April 19 from 1 to 4 p.m.

Want to do some arts & crafts? Well UC Live offers that too at the Warhawk Connection Center. All are free to the UW-Whitewater students, with the use of your Hawkcard, and are a first come, first serve. There is a DIY stickers and patches workshop Tuesday, Feb. 20, Succulent Workshop Tuesday, April 9, and a Warhawk Craft Night Tuesday, April 23.
